SMTP, or Simple Mail Protocol , is the primary process by which email correspondence are delivered over the web . Think of it as the mailing network with electronic mail; it facilitates email clients like Outlook or Gmail to interact with email platforms. This explanation briefly explores the core concepts of SMTP, in order to you can start to grasp how email really functions . It’s generally involved than just clicking “send”, but this explanation will provide a concise picture .

Fixing Common Email System Issues
Experiencing trouble with your mail delivery? Quite a few common errors can hinder correct sending of emails. To begin with, verify your mail platform configurations – including the hostname, gateway, and credentials. Next, review your firewall configuration to ensure it isn't blocking outbound traffic. Finally, check your from internet protocol standing; a damaged status can lead to denial of your mail. Logging and examining error logs are also essential for pinpointing the root cause of the error.
Secure Your Emails: Best Practices for SMTP Configuration
Protecting your email communications is vital in today's online landscape. Correct SMTP configuration is key to ensuring secure delivery and preventing unauthorized access. Here's a look at key best practices to establish :
- Use SSL : Consistently enable Transport Layer Security (TLS) or Secure Sockets Layer (SSL) – or the STARTTLS command – to protect the connection between your machine and the receiving mail host.
- Secure Authentication: Implement robust authentication protocols like Password-Based Authentication or API keys to verify the transmitter. Disable less protected options like plain text keys.
- Limit Access: Thoroughly configure your SMTP host to restrict access based on IP addresses . Permit access only from trusted sources.
- Periodically Monitor Logs: Keep a vigilant eye on your SMTP server logs to detect any unusual activity.
- Update Software: Ensure your SMTP system software is frequently updated with the latest security patches.
By implementing these straightforward steps, you can significantly improve the safe of your email communications .
